Kelly Clarkson made a blind pick of the Seattle Seahawks, expressing genuine excitement for her choice. On the other hand, Donald Trump chose to remain neutral, praising both teams for their accomplishments. While he didn't reveal his pick, he acknowledged the talent of both teams, avoiding any potential awkward situations.
Kendall Jenner, appearing on “The Tonight Show with Jimmy Fallon,” revealed her pick for the Patriots, adding to the mix of celebrity predictions. Despite some divided opinions, many celebrities seem to be leaning towards the Seattle Seahawks as the favored team for the Super Bowl.
Puka Nacua, who faced the Seahawks in the NFC Championship, opted not to root for either team but instead showed support for Cooper Kupp. San Francisco Mayor Daniel Lurie also refrained from picking a side, declaring the game a win for San Francisco, following a similar path as Donald Trump.
